TransAstra Corporation's Overview

TransAstra Corporation, based in Los Angeles, CA, is an innovative player in the industrials sector, specifically focusing on aviation and space. Launched in 2021, the company participated in Y Combinator's S21 batch. With a compact yet dynamic team of 8, TransAstra is making significant strides in the rapidly expanding space economy. The company has secured more than $5 million in revenue and holds five issued patents, with over a dozen more pending. Their technological advancements, particularly in propulsion and telescopic systems, are set to revolutionize space logistics and resource identification.

TransAstra Corporation's Omnivore Propulsion System

TransAstra's Omnivore propulsion system is a groundbreaking innovation in the space industry. This system uses water or virtually any fluid as a propellant, relying solely on concentrated sunlight for power. It is designed to be faster, cheaper, and more practical than traditional electric propulsion systems. Moreover, it is substantially less expensive, safer, and more operationally flexible compared to legacy chemical propulsion systems. The Omnivore propulsion system represents a significant leap forward in making space travel and logistics more feasible and cost-effective, promising to impact both commercial and national defense applications.

TransAstra Corporation's Sutter Telescope System

The Sutter Telescope System by TransAstra is designed to identify and locate resource-rich asteroids and orbital debris. This system works synergistically with the Worker Bee Orbital Transfer Vehicle (OTV) for efficient orbital logistics. The Sutter Telescope is not only vital for commercial space endeavors but also plays a crucial role in national defense by identifying dark, fast-moving objects between Earth and the Moon. Ground-based observatories equipped with the Sutter system will soon begin commercial sales of Space Domain Awareness (SDA) data, which is projected to be 300,000 times more cost-effective than existing telescope designs.

TransAstra Corporation's Patents and Innovations

TransAstra Corporation has a robust intellectual property portfolio, with five issued patents and more than a dozen additional patents pending. These patents cover core business lines and underscore the company's commitment to pioneering new technologies in the space sector. The company's innovations, such as the Omnivore propulsion system and the Sutter Telescope System, highlight their strategic approach to solving complex challenges in space logistics and resource identification. These patented technologies are set to offer substantial advantages in terms of cost, safety, and operational flexibility, positioning TransAstra as a leader in the space economy.
